Duffy joins Thornton Tomasetti

Thomas Duffy, P.E., a structural engineer with more than 25 years of experience in bridge and kinetic structures, has joined Thornton Tomasetti as a Senior Vice President. Duffy, previously a Principal Associate with Thornton Tomasetti's strategic partner Hardesty & Hanover, will be working closely with Building Performance Practice Leader and Managing Principal Gary Panariello, Ph.D., P.E., S.E.

Duffy’s move to Thornton Tomasetti will enhance the firm’s expertise in three key areas: bridge and transportation forensics; kinetic structure design, especially movable roofs for stadiums; and business development across the Building Performance practice. +
